scss换为less

This commit is contained in:
zyronon 2021-10-03 14:08:04 +08:00
parent 9013e2c7fd
commit 031ec8318e
96 changed files with 121 additions and 97 deletions

View File

@ -31,7 +31,8 @@
"eslint-plugin-vue": "^7.0.0",
"less": "^4.1.1",
"less-loader": "^7.0.0",
"mobile-select": "^1.1.2"
"mobile-select": "^1.1.2",
"raw-loader": "^4.0.2"
},
"eslintConfig": {
"root": false,

View File

@ -1,4 +1,3 @@
@use "sass:math";
///*

View File

@ -78,7 +78,7 @@ export default {
</script>
<style scoped lang="less">
@import "../assets/scss/index";
@import "../assets/less/index";
.button {
color: white;

View File

@ -54,7 +54,7 @@ export default {
</script>
<style scoped lang="less">
@import "../assets/scss/index";
@import "../assets/less/index";
#BaseHeader {
width: 100%;

View File

@ -34,7 +34,7 @@ export default {
</script>
<style scoped lang="less">
@import "../assets/scss/index";
@import "../assets/less/index";
.check {
@width: 1.4rem;

View File

@ -319,7 +319,7 @@ export default {
</script>
<style lang="less" scoped>
@import "../assets/scss/index";
@import "../assets/less/index";
.title {
z-index: 2;

View File

@ -67,7 +67,7 @@ export default {
</script>
<style scoped lang="less">
@import "../assets/scss/index";
@import "../assets/less/index";
.DouyinCode {
position: fixed;

View File

@ -17,7 +17,7 @@ export default {
</script>
<style scoped lang="less">
@import "../assets/scss/index";
@import "../assets/less/index";
.Loading {

View File

@ -11,7 +11,7 @@ export default {
</script>
<style scoped lang="less">
@import "../assets/scss/index";
@import "../assets/less/index";
.NoMore {
font-size: 1.2rem;

View File

@ -35,7 +35,7 @@ export default {
</script>
<style scoped lang="less">
@import "../assets/scss/index";
@import "../assets/less/index";
.scroll-wrapper {
overflow: auto;

View File

@ -69,7 +69,7 @@ export default {
</script>
<style scoped lang="less">
@import "../assets/scss/color";
@import "../assets/less/color";
.search-ctn {
display: flex;

View File

@ -225,7 +225,7 @@ export default {
</script>
<style lang="less" scoped>
@import "../assets/scss/index";
@import "../assets/less/index";
.share {
width: 100%;

View File

@ -345,7 +345,7 @@ export default {
</script>
<style scoped lang="less">
@import "../assets/scss/color";
@import "../assets/less/color";
.fade-enter-active,
.fade-leave-active {

View File

@ -79,7 +79,7 @@ export default {
</script>
<style scoped lang="less">
@import "../../assets/scss/index";
@import "../../assets/less/index";
.ConfirmDialog {
z-index: 10;

View File

@ -17,7 +17,7 @@ export default {
</script>
<style scoped lang="less">
@import "../../assets/scss/index";
@import "../../assets/less/index";
.FadeDialog {
position: fixed;

View File

@ -192,7 +192,7 @@ export default {
</script>
<style scoped lang="less">
@import "../../assets/scss/index";
@import "../../assets/less/index";
.FromBottomDialog {
z-index: 9;

View File

@ -54,7 +54,7 @@ export default {
</script>
<style scoped lang="less">
@import "../../assets/scss/index";
@import "../../assets/less/index";
.NoticeDialog {
z-index: 10;

View File

@ -118,7 +118,7 @@ export default {
</script>
<style scoped lang="less">
@import "../../assets/scss/index";
@import "../../assets/less/index";
.indicator-ctn {
font-size: 1.4rem;

View File

@ -327,7 +327,7 @@ export default {
</script>
<style scoped lang="less">
@import "../../assets/scss/index";
@import "../../assets/less/index";
#base-slide-wrapper {
width: 100%;

View File

@ -305,7 +305,7 @@ export default {
</script>
<style scoped lang="less">
@import "../../assets/scss/index";
@import "../../assets/less/index";
#base-slide-wrapper {
width: 100%;

View File

@ -415,7 +415,7 @@ export default {
</script>
<style scoped lang="less">
@import "../../assets/scss/index";
@import "../../assets/less/index";
#base-slide-wrapper {
width: 100%;

View File

@ -344,7 +344,7 @@ export default {
</script>
<style scoped lang="less">
@import "../../assets/scss/index";
@import "../../assets/less/index";
#base-slide-wrapper {
width: 100%;

View File

@ -1,7 +1,7 @@
import * as Vue from 'vue'
import App from './App.vue'
import mitt from 'mitt'
import './assets/scss/index.less'
import './assets/less/index.less'
import './mock'// 导入 mock 数据处理
import api from './api'
import router from "./router";

View File

@ -30,7 +30,7 @@ export default {
</script>
<style scoped lang="less">
@import "../assets/scss/index";
@import "../assets/less/index";
.Test {

View File

@ -120,7 +120,7 @@ export default {
</script>
<style scoped lang="less">
@import "../assets/scss/index";
@import "../assets/less/index";
.Test {
position: fixed;

View File

@ -74,7 +74,7 @@ export default {
</script>
<style lang="less">
@import "../assets/scss/index";
@import "../assets/less/index";
.test {
position: fixed;

View File

@ -34,7 +34,7 @@ export default {
</script>
<style scoped lang="less">
@import "../assets/scss/index";
@import "../assets/less/index";
.Test {
position: fixed;

View File

@ -202,7 +202,7 @@ export default {
</script>
<style scoped lang="less">
@import "../assets/scss/index";
@import "../assets/less/index";
.Test {
position: fixed;

View File

@ -392,7 +392,7 @@ export default {
</script>
<style scoped lang="less">
@import "../../assets/scss/index";
@import "../../assets/less/index";
#attention {
/*background: rgb(222434);*/

View File

@ -233,7 +233,7 @@ export default {
</script>
<style lang="less">
@import "../../assets/scss/index";
@import "../../assets/less/index";
.send-gift {
position: fixed;
@ -404,7 +404,7 @@ export default {
</style>
<style scoped lang="less">
@import "../../assets/scss/index";
@import "../../assets/less/index";
.LivePage {
width: 100vw;

View File

@ -204,7 +204,7 @@ export default {
<style scoped lang="less">
@import "../../assets/scss/index";
@import "../../assets/less/index";
#Music {
position: fixed;

View File

@ -422,7 +422,7 @@ export default {
</script>
<style scoped lang="less">
@import "../../assets/scss/index";
@import "../../assets/less/index";
.MusicRankList {
position: fixed;

View File

@ -85,7 +85,7 @@ export default {
</script>
<style scoped lang="less">
@import "../../assets/scss/index";
@import "../../assets/less/index";
.Publish {
position: fixed;

View File

@ -123,7 +123,7 @@ export default {
</script>
<style scoped lang="less">
@import "../../assets/scss/index";
@import "../../assets/less/index";
.Report {
position: fixed;

View File

@ -660,7 +660,7 @@ export default {
</script>
<style scoped lang="less">
@import "../../assets/scss/index";
@import "../../assets/less/index";
.Search {
position: fixed;

View File

@ -71,7 +71,7 @@ export default {
</script>
<style scoped lang="less">
@import "../../assets/scss/index";
@import "../../assets/less/index";
.Report {
position: fixed;

View File

@ -49,7 +49,7 @@ export default {
</script>
<style scoped lang="less">
@import "../../../assets/scss/index";
@import "../../../assets/less/index";
.share-to-duoshan {
padding: 3rem 2rem;

View File

@ -88,7 +88,7 @@ export default {
</script>
<style scoped lang="less">
@import "../../../assets/scss/index";
@import "../../../assets/less/index";
.follow-setting-dialog {
padding: 1.5rem;

View File

@ -71,7 +71,7 @@ export default {
</script>
<style scoped lang="less">
@import "../../../assets/scss/index";
@import "../../../assets/less/index";
.follow-setting-dialog {
padding: 1.5rem;

View File

@ -118,7 +118,7 @@ export default {
</script>
<style scoped lang="less">
@import "../../../assets/scss/index";
@import "../../../assets/less/index";
.play-feedback {
max-height: 49rem;

View File

@ -231,7 +231,7 @@ export default {
</script>
<style scoped lang="less">
@import "../../../assets/scss/index";
@import "../../../assets/less/index";
.option-dialog {
.buttons {

View File

@ -163,7 +163,7 @@ export default {
</script>
<style scoped lang="less">
@import "../../../assets/scss/index";
@import "../../../assets/less/index";
.button {
width: 6.4rem;

View File

@ -1,4 +1,4 @@
@import "../../assets/scss/index";
@import "../../assets/less/index.less";
.content {
padding: 3rem;

View File

@ -28,7 +28,7 @@ export default {
</script>
<style scoped lang="less">
@import "../../assets/scss/index";
@import "../../assets/less/index";
.Help {
position: fixed;

View File

@ -95,7 +95,7 @@ export default {
</script>
<style scoped lang="less">
@import "../../assets/scss/index";
@import "../../assets/less/index";
.login {
position: fixed;

View File

@ -116,8 +116,8 @@ export default {
</script>
<style scoped lang="less">
@import "../../assets/scss/index";
@import "Base.scss";
@import "../../assets/less/index";
@import "Base.less";
.other-login {
position: fixed;

View File

@ -85,8 +85,8 @@ export default {
</script>
<style scoped lang="less">
@import "../../assets/scss/index";
@import "Base.scss";
@import "../../assets/less/index";
@import "Base.less";
.PasswordLogin {
position: fixed;

View File

@ -129,8 +129,8 @@ export default {
</script>
<style scoped lang="less">
@import "../../assets/scss/index";
@import "Base.scss";
@import "../../assets/less/index";
@import "Base.less";
.RetrievePassword {
position: fixed;

View File

@ -91,8 +91,8 @@ export default {
</script>
<style scoped lang="less">
@import "../../assets/scss/index";
@import "Base.scss";
@import "../../assets/less/index";
@import "Base.less";
.VerificationCode {
position: fixed;

View File

@ -116,7 +116,7 @@ export default {
</script>
<style scoped lang="less">
@import "../../../assets/scss/index";
@import "../../../assets/less/index";
.input-number {
display: flex;

View File

@ -26,7 +26,7 @@ export default {
</script>
<style scoped lang="less">
@import "../../../assets/scss/index";
@import "../../../assets/less/index";
.scale-enter-active,
.scale-leave-active {

View File

@ -2433,7 +2433,7 @@ export default {
</script>
<style scoped lang="less">
@import "../../assets/scss/index";
@import "../../assets/less/index";
.countryChoose {
position: fixed;

View File

@ -1,4 +1,4 @@
@import "../../assets/scss/index";
@import "../../assets/less/index";
.fade1-enter-active,
.fade1-leave-active {

View File

@ -117,7 +117,7 @@ export default {
</script>
<style scoped lang="less">
@import "../../assets/scss/index";
@import "../../assets/less/index";
#MyCard {
background: rgb(136, 132, 133);

View File

@ -74,7 +74,8 @@
import {mapState} from "vuex";
import globalMethods from "../../utils/global-methods";
import {nextTick} from "vue";
import lyricsFaruxue from '../../assets/data/lyrics/faruxue.txt'
// import lyricsFaruxue from '../../assets/data/lyrics/faruxue.txt'
import lyricsFaruxue from '../../assets/data/lyrics/faruxue.lrc'
export default {
@ -258,7 +259,7 @@ export default {
</script>
<style scoped lang="less">
@import "../../assets/scss/index";
@import "../../assets/less/index";
.MyMusic {
position: fixed;

View File

@ -76,7 +76,7 @@ export default {
</script>
<style scoped lang="less">
@import "../../assets/scss/index";
@import "../../assets/less/index";
.RequestUpdate {
position: fixed;

View File

@ -1,4 +1,4 @@
@import "../../assets/scss/index";
@import "../../assets/less/index";
.fade1-enter-active,
.fade1-leave-active {

View File

@ -374,7 +374,7 @@ export default {
</script>
<style scoped lang="less">
@import "../../assets/scss/index";
@import "../../assets/less/index";
#video-detail {

View File

@ -133,7 +133,7 @@ export default {
</script>
<style scoped lang="less">
@import "@/assets/scss/index";
@import "@/assets/less/index";
.MusicCollect {
position: fixed;

View File

@ -37,7 +37,7 @@ export default {
</script>
<style scoped lang="less">
@import "../../../assets/scss/index";
@import "../../../assets/less/index";
.VideoCollect {
position: fixed;

View File

@ -64,7 +64,7 @@ export default {
</script>
<style scoped lang="less">
@import "../../../assets/scss/index";
@import "../../../assets/less/index";
.lookHistory {
position: fixed;

View File

@ -86,7 +86,7 @@ export default {
</script>
<style scoped lang="less">
@import "../../../../assets/scss/index";
@import "../../../../assets/less/index";
.DetailSetting {
position: fixed;

View File

@ -44,7 +44,7 @@ export default {
</script>
<style scoped lang="less">
@import "../../../../assets/scss/index";
@import "../../../../assets/less/index";
.index {
position: fixed;

View File

@ -57,7 +57,7 @@ export default {
</script>
<style scoped lang="less">
@import "../../../../assets/scss/index";
@import "../../../../assets/less/index";
.TriggerTime {
position: fixed;

View File

@ -198,7 +198,7 @@ export default {
</script>
<style scoped lang="less">
@import "../../../assets/scss/index";
@import "../../../assets/less/index";
.Setting {
position: fixed;

View File

@ -162,7 +162,7 @@ export default {
</script>
<style scoped lang="less">
@import "../../../assets/scss/index";
@import "../../../assets/less/index";
.school {
position: fixed;

View File

@ -67,7 +67,7 @@ export default {
</script>
<style scoped lang="less">
@import "../../../assets/scss/index";
@import "../../../assets/less/index";
.choose-location {
position: fixed;

View File

@ -52,7 +52,7 @@ export default {
</script>
<style scoped lang="less">
@import "../../../assets/scss/index";
@import "../../../assets/less/index";
.choose-school {
position: fixed;

View File

@ -1206,7 +1206,7 @@ export default {
</script>
<style scoped lang="less">
@import "../../../assets/scss/index";
@import "../../../assets/less/index";
.choose-location {
position: fixed;

View File

@ -36,7 +36,7 @@ export default {
</script>
<style scoped lang="less">
@import "../../../assets/scss/index";
@import "../../../assets/less/index";
.choose-location {
position: fixed;

View File

@ -97,7 +97,7 @@ export default {
</script>
<style scoped lang="less">
@import "../../../assets/scss/index";
@import "../../../assets/less/index";
.choose-school {
position: fixed;

View File

@ -58,7 +58,7 @@ export default {
</script>
<style scoped lang="less">
@import "../../../assets/scss/index";
@import "../../../assets/less/index";
.declare-school {
position: fixed;

View File

@ -52,7 +52,7 @@ export default {
</script>
<style scoped lang="less">
@import "../../../assets/scss/index";
@import "../../../assets/less/index";
.DisplayType {
position: fixed;

View File

@ -147,7 +147,7 @@ export default {
</script>
<style scoped lang="less">
@import "../../../assets/scss/index";
@import "../../../assets/less/index";
.edit {
position: fixed;

View File

@ -104,7 +104,7 @@ export default {
</script>
<style scoped lang="less">
@import "../../../assets/scss/index";
@import "../../../assets/less/index";
.edit-item {
position: fixed;

View File

@ -387,7 +387,7 @@ export default {
</script>
<style scoped lang="less">
@import "../../assets/scss/index";
@import "../../assets/less/index";
.Chat {
position: fixed;

View File

@ -89,7 +89,7 @@ export default {
</script>
<style scoped lang="less">
@import "../../assets/scss/index";
@import "../../assets/less/index";
.ChatDetail {
position: fixed;

View File

@ -87,7 +87,7 @@ export default {
</script>
<style scoped lang="less">
@import "../../assets/scss/index";
@import "../../assets/less/index";
.Share2Friend {
position: fixed;

View File

@ -239,7 +239,7 @@ export default {
</script>
<style scoped lang="less">
@import "../../assets/scss/index";
@import "../../assets/less/index";
::-webkit-scrollbar {
display: none; /* Chrome Safari */

View File

@ -63,7 +63,7 @@ export default {
</script>
<style scoped lang="less">
@import "../../assets/scss/index";
@import "../../assets/less/index";
.edit-item {
position: fixed;

View File

@ -323,7 +323,7 @@ export default {
</script>
<style scoped lang="less">
@import "../../assets/scss/index";
@import "../../assets/less/index";
.Share2Friend {
position: fixed;

View File

@ -42,7 +42,7 @@ export default {
</script>
<style scoped lang="less">
@import "../../../assets/scss/index";
@import "../../../assets/less/index";
.block-dialog {
color: black;

View File

@ -160,7 +160,7 @@ export default {
</script>
<style scoped lang="less">
@import "../../../assets/scss/index";
@import "../../../assets/less/index";
.ChatMessage {
padding: 0 1rem;

View File

@ -1723,7 +1723,7 @@ export default {
</script>
<style scoped lang="less">
@import "../../assets/scss/index";
@import "../../assets/less/index";
.ServiceProtocol {
position: fixed;

View File

@ -44,7 +44,7 @@ export default {
</script>
<style scoped lang="less">
@import "../../assets/scss/index";
@import "../../assets/less/index";
.AddressList {
position: fixed;

View File

@ -24,7 +24,7 @@ export default {
</script>
<style scoped lang="less">
@import "../../assets/scss/index";
@import "../../assets/less/index";
.FaceToFace {
background: black;

View File

@ -201,7 +201,7 @@ export default {
</script>
<style scoped lang="less">
@import "../../assets/scss/index";
@import "../../assets/less/index";
.from-bottom-enter-active,
.from-bottom-leave-active {

View File

@ -38,7 +38,7 @@ export default {
</script>
<style scoped lang="less">
@import "../../assets/scss/index";
@import "../../assets/less/index";
.Scan {
position: fixed;

View File

@ -71,7 +71,7 @@ export default {
</script>
<style scoped lang="less">
@import "../../../assets/scss/index";
@import "../../../assets/less/index";
.scale-enter-active,
.scale-leave-active {

View File

@ -1,12 +1,35 @@
// vue.config.js
const path = require('path')
const isProduction = process.env.NODE_ENV === 'production'
module.exports = {
publicPath: isProduction ? '' : '',
assetsDir: isProduction ? './' : './',
// productionSourceMap: false,
lintOnSave:false, //关闭eslint检查
devServer:{
lintOnSave: false, //关闭eslint检查
devServer: {
open: true,
},
// chainWebpack: config => {
// config.module
// .rule('txt')
// .test( /\.(txt|lrc)$/)
// .use('raw-loader')
// .loader('raw-loader')
// .end()
// },
configureWebpack: {
module: {
rules: [
{
//解析txt、lrc文件
test: /\.(txt|lrc)$/,
exclude: /node_modules/,
include: path.join(__dirname, 'src'),
use: ['raw-loader']
}
]
},
}
}